java web实现增删改查后,应该学习哪些高级技术?

做了个小项目,实现了curd,想继续往缓存,并发,负载高级深入,请推荐一个详细的高级技术路线?最好有书

javaweb深入浅出,不过这个方向研究,主要还是在公司里学的会更实用些

多线程,Socket,I/O
JSP、EL、JSTL,AJAX
JavaScript,jQuery
JSON,XML
EJB(可忽略)
各种框架
......太多了

多线程,Socket,I/O
JSP、EL、JSTL,AJAX
JavaScript,jQuery
JSON,XML
EJB(可忽略)
各种框架
......太多了

报表,存储,定时,邮件,打包EXCEL,ZIp等等。

看看框架吧,SSH,spring MVC ,mybatis